Spanish Bank Offers Round-the-Clock Bitcoin Access; Stock Surges
BBVA, Spain’s second-largest financial institution, rolled out 24/7 cryptocurrency buying and selling for home retail shoppers on October 2. It grew to become the primary main lender within the nation to combine Bitcoin and Ether into its mainstream cellular banking platform.
Approved by Spain’s CNMV, the launch stands as one of many first main functions of the EU’s MiCA framework. It is anticipated to affect European banks that stay cautious about retail crypto companies.
BBVA Launches First Mobile Crypto Trading
Banco Bilbao Vizcaya Argentaria (BBVA) confirmed that its clients can now purchase, promote, and custody Bitcoin and Ether immediately by its cellular app, with trades executed utilizing the identical rails the financial institution applies to overseas change. This integration ensures customers expertise a well-recognized and controlled buying and selling atmosphere.
Luis Martins, BBVA’s world head of macro buying and selling, mentioned the transfer displays rising demand from on a regular basis traders.
“Digital belongings are quickly changing into a part of world finance. Our shoppers anticipate to entry them by the identical trusted methods they already use,” Martins commented.
The rollout is supported by Singapore-based SGX FX, whose know-how supplies pricing, aggregation, and threat administration for monetary establishments. COO Vinay Trivedi mentioned the system lets banks add crypto with out full-stack alternative, decreasing boundaries to entry.
Implications for European Banking
BBVA’s early adoption could stress peers across Europe to follow suit. MiCA clarifies guidelines for digital belongings, and banks corresponding to KBC and Deutsche Bank have explored blockchain however not but launched 24/7 crypto buying and selling.
In 2025, BBVA secured MiCA authorization from Spain’s CNMV. It started with a restricted pilot of a number of thousand customers earlier than increasing to all eligible Spanish retail shoppers in July. The financial institution stored crypto orders and custody inside its personal digital banking stack.
Earlier in the summertime, BBVA Switzerland additionally suggested rich shoppers to contemplate a 3%–7% crypto allocation.
Meanwhile, BBVA shares have additionally mirrored rising curiosity within the financial institution’s digital technique. As of October 2, the inventory traded round $19.08, displaying regular momentum after earlier features. Daily quantity has exceeded a million shares, highlighting energetic investor participation.
The inventory has surged about 96% from $9.50 firstly of the yr. This close to‑doubling of share worth highlights the market’s recognition of its pioneering function in bringing crypto companies into mainstream banking.
While the rapid impression of the crypto launch continues to be being assessed, investor sentiment has improved as BBVA positions itself forward of European friends in adopting digital belongings.
